Ladenburg Thalmann Financial Services Inc., through its subsidiaries, provides brokerage and advisory, investment banking, equity research, institutional sales and trading, asset management, and trust services. The company operates through two segments, Independent Brokerage and Advisory Services, and Ladenburg. The Independent Brokerage and Advisory Services segment offers securities brokerage and advisory services for mutual funds, variable annuities, and advisor managed accounts; advisor managed accounts; and trust administration of personal and retirement accounts, estate and financial planning, wealth management, and custody services. This segment also provides brokerage support services, including access to stock, bond and options execution; products, such as insurance, mutual funds, unit trusts and investment advisory programs; and research, compliance, supervision, accounting, and related services. The Ladenburg segment engages in investment banking activities comprising corporate finance and strategic and financial advisory services; and sales and trading business, as well as provides research services, including reviewing and analyzing general market conditions and other industry groups, issuing written reports on companies, furnishing information to retail and institutional customers, and responding to inquires from customers and account executives. This segment also offers various asset management products and services comprise asset management program, investment consulting services, alternative strategies fund, private investment management program, retirement plan sponsor services, alternative investments, architect program, and third-party advisory services. The company was founded in 1876 and is headquartered in Miami, Florida. Key Statistics
